Megadeth confirm farewell tour with tickets and presale this week | Music | Entertainment

Metal icons Megadeth have confirmed a brand new tour is taking place next year in the UK. The rock geniuses behind ‘Holy Wars… The Punishment Due’ and ‘Symphony of Destruction’ have announced their upcoming arena tour, ‘Breakout: Hibernation of the Nations’ will kick off in March, acting as a farewell tour for the historic band. And they have some massive shows lined up, as well.

Megadeth will make their way to the UK on March 11, 2027, when they will play at London’s Wembley Arena. From there, they’ll continue to play some of the country’s biggest arenas, including Nottingham’s Motorpoint Arena, Manchester’s Co-op Live and Glasgow’s OVO Hydro. The band’s frontman Dave Mustaine said this is more of a “celebration” than a “goodbye”, though. Dave Mustaine has spoken candidly about the band’s upcoming farewell tour: “This isn’t about saying goodbye. It’s about celebrating everything we’ve built together over the last four decades. Every city has its own story, every crowd has given us unforgettable memories, and we want to come back to celebrate that with the fans who made it all possible.

“When we started talking about this tour, we wanted it to be a true celebration of metal. Black Label Society and Testament are bands we have tremendous respect for, and having them join us makes these shows even more special. This lineup represents decades of heavy music, and it’s going to be an incredible night for the fans.”
